天堂草原最受欢迎的角色,天堂动漫,天堂在线,色天堂下载,天堂中文在线资源,亚洲男人天堂

技術熱線: 4007-888-234
設計開發

專注差異化嵌入式產品解決方案 給智能產品定制注入靈魂給予生命

開發工具

提供開發工具、應用測試 完善的開發代碼案例庫分享

技術支持

從全面的產品導入到強大技術支援服務 全程貼心伴隨服務,創造無限潛能!

新聞中心

提供最新的單片機資訊,行業消息以及公司新聞動態

電子設計自動化是什么?深入解讀發展趨勢

更新時間: 2021-11-08
閱讀量:3435

電子設計自動化(下文簡稱EDA)工具可供在集成電路、印刷電路板和系統級工作的工程師使用。英銳恩單片機開發工程師將深入介紹EDA到目前為止如何為電子產品開發做出貢獻,以及它在未來如何繼續發展。

1947年貝爾實驗室晶體管的發明引發了電子技術的爆炸式增長,這個行業也深刻地改變了我們的生活方式。隨著公司爭先恐后地搶占市場,并從新技術機會中獲得最大利潤,不斷推動著更小、更強大設備的發展和出現。

特雷西·基德(Tracy Kidder)于1981年撰寫的一本非小說類、普利策獎獲獎書籍《新機器的靈魂》(The Soul of A New Machine)生動地說明了風險的大小以及科技公司為成為贏家而付出的努力。Data General于1980年開發下一代計算機,以防止Digital Equipment Corporation(DEC)實現對新32位小型計算機市場的統治。本書的一個關鍵主題是工程質量和上市時間之間的緊張關系。這一直是一個潛在的問題,如果不是實際問題,但已經被電子設計自動化(EDA)——有時稱為電子計算機輔助設計(ECAD)——工具的出現和發展所緩解。它們可用于促進集成電路(IC)、印刷電路板(PCB)和完整的系統設計。

20211108181755.jpg

下面,英銳恩單片機開發工程師將深入的介紹IC EDA如何演變成目前的形式,以及一些預計會影響其持續發展的因素。

一、EDA的演變

在EDA開發之前,集成電路是手工設計和手工布局的。一些先進的商店使用幾何軟件為Gerber光繪機生成磁帶,生成單色曝光圖像,但即使是那些復制機械繪制組件的數字記錄。這個過程基本上是圖形化的,從電子到圖形的轉換是手動完成的。到1970年代中期,開發人員開始在繪圖之外實現電路設計的自動化,并開發了第一個布局和布線工具。

隨著Carver Mead和Lynn Conway于1980年出版了“超大規模集成電路系統簡介”,下一個時代開始了。這篇開創性的文本提倡使用編譯為硅的編程語言進行芯片設計。直接的結果是可以設計的芯片的復雜性顯著增加,并且改進了對使用邏輯仿真的設計驗證工具的訪問。通常,芯片更容易布局并且更可能正確運行,因為它們的設計可以在構建之前進行更徹底的模擬。

盡管語言和工具已經發展,但這種在文本編程語言中指定所需行為并讓工具導出詳細物理設計的通用方法仍然是當今數字IC設計的基礎。

當前的數字流是極其模塊化的,前端生成標準化的設計描述,這些描述編譯成類似于單元的單元調用,而不考慮它們的個別技術。單元通過使用特定的集成電路技術來實現邏輯或其他電子功能。制造商通常為其生產過程提供組件庫,以及適合標準仿真工具的仿真模型。模擬EDA工具的模塊化程度要低得多,因為需要更多的功能,它們之間的相互作用更加強烈,而且組件通常不太理想。

二、EDA的未來趨勢

在半導體產業被要求產生更為復雜的集成電路(IC),有幾個原因。影響之一是汽車客戶對開發更多連接功能的需求不斷增長,例如高級駕駛輔助系統(ADAS)和電動或混合動力汽車。ADAS通過其人工智能幫助駕駛員避免分心并減輕他們的壓力——它的增長刺激了對其運行的復雜IC的需求。市場上自動駕駛汽車的出現將進一步刺激復雜半導體需求的激增。

ADAS只是推動人工智能(AI)及其相關機器學習(ML)和深度學習(DL)技術發展的眾多應用之一。半導體制造商必須提供更復雜的IC,例如具有數百個內核、TB級內存和多個高速通信通道的CPU和GPU,并且需要越來越復雜的EDA工具來幫助他們。

此外,開發人員經常發現需要通過構建專用邏輯來優化其AI性能,而不會影響功耗。為給定的應用程序開發正確的AI架構需要EDA工具,這些工具可以處理更高級別的抽象。西門子旗下的Mentor開始看到其Catapult HLS(高層次合成)技術的業務增長,這些技術為為其片上系統(SoC)設計開發AIIP加速器的公司提供了服務。

這使AI架構師能夠開發他們的數學代碼,將其轉換為C或System C,并預先了解算法的哪些部分應該在硬件和軟件中實現。然后他們可以更快地收斂到理想的架構,而不是立即嘗試進入寄存器傳輸(RT)級別。

雖然EDA可以幫助設計人工智能解決方案,但人工智能同樣可以用于改進EDA工具。在過去幾年中,Mentor的研發人員一直在將ML集成到他們自己的EDA工具中。該公司目前有五種商用工具產品,它們利用ML來幫助交付更好的結果,并更快地交付它們。

ML可以提高EDA性能,因為ML需要大量數據才能有效——而EDA會產生大量數據。事實上,EDA數據非常容易獲得,當將ML用于EDA時,問題就變成了:哪些數據集可以有效地用于哪些工具功能?

以上就是英銳恩單片機開發工程師分享的“電子設計自動化是什么?深入解讀發展趨勢”。英銳恩專注單片機應用方案設計與開發,提供8位單片機、16位單片機、32位單片機。

联系我们: 泾阳县| 通山县| 涿鹿县| 绩溪县| 汉中市| 石家庄市| 彰武县| 泰宁县| 郓城县| 磐石市| 普宁市| 吉木萨尔县| 三河市| 成都市| 牟定县| 岳普湖县| 康保县| 中西区| 通州区| 邮箱| 岳池县| 东乌珠穆沁旗| 深圳市| 定南县| 九江县| 赤壁市| 福泉市| 宣城市| 南汇区| 江达县| 西平县| 郸城县| 金秀| 平邑县| 雅江县| 江陵县| 固安县| 海丰县| 大石桥市| 洪江市| 佳木斯市|